You'd want to create a retainage payable account on your Chart of Accounts. Let me show you how:
- Go to the Accounting menu.
- Choose the Chart of Accounts tab.
- Click New.
- Under the Account Type drop-down menu, select Other Current Liabilities.
- On the Detail Type drop-down menu, choose Other Current Liabilities.
- In the Name field, enter Retainage Payable.
- Click Save and Close.
Once completed, you can create a retainer service item. You can use it in creating a sales receipt or an invoice to record the amount you've received from your customers. Here's:
- Choose the Gear icon ⚙.
- Select Products and Services.
- Click New.
- From the Product/Service information panel, pick Service.
- Enter a name for the new product or service item (ex. Retainer).
- From the Income account ▼ drop-down menu, select Trust Liability Account.
- Click Save and close.
